Compare all specifications:
2008 Citroen C6 | 2010 Audi A5 | |
Make | Citroen | Audi |
Model | C6 | A5 |
Year Released | 2008 | 2010 |
Body Type | Sedan |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2720 cc | 3197 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Horse Power | 201 HP | 261 HP |
Engine RPM | 4200 RPM | 6500 RPM |
Torque | 440 Nm | 330 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1900 RPM | 3000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1870 kg | 1760 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4910 mm | 4623 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1870 mm | 1852 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1470 mm | 1382 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2910 mm | 2751 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 72 L | 67 L |
